Counter Strike Source Random Lag Spikes Causing Low FPS

okay so i bought counter strike source about a month ago and for about two weeks now i have been getting lag spikes occuring every 10-15 minutes that last about 2 minutes each time. this is not my internets problem because i have tries hosting and it also has lag spikes so it makes no sense. My internet speed is average and my computer is actually great for gaming. My specs are...

I am running Windows 7
2.60 GHz Processor
RAM 8GB (7.75 Which are usable)
64-bit Operating system

Basically, ive tried everything possible to fix it that i know of and i've had no luck. if anyone can please tell me a way i can fix these lag spikes i would greatly appreciate it. Btw, i think it might be a Windows 7 problem??? im not sure though. help!

Lets start with the basics:

Are you running an antivirus or p2p programs in the background as these are known to use system resources and bandwidth, if so then disable them.

Is Steam downloading an update in the background? if so, disable it.

What are the settings in your config.cfg file for the following:

  • rate
  • cl_updaterate
  • cl_cmdrate

The defaults for these settings are:

  • rate 20000
  • cl_updaterate 101
  • cl_cmdrate 101

The average setting (for most players is:

  • rate 18000
  • cl_updaterate 60
  • cl_cmdrate 60

But you can play around with them, generally RATE is set between 15000-20000 and CMDRATE + UPDATERATE are the same as your average FPS, so 80FPS would give CL_CMDRATE 80 + CL_UPDATERATE 80.

A good place to start with the UPDATERATE + CMDRATE is 30 and work up to 250 and see which value gives you the best results.

In addition to what Lister said. Check if you have any Messenger Clients or Ingame Chat Clients open. Sometimes Ingame Chat Clients like Xfire could download patches and files in the background and cause lag spikes.
Messenger Clients could hog up memory as well.

EDIT: You should also probably check your computer for viruses. I had this exact problem once and it was due to some weird virus that was slowing down my internet and my computer and weird times for like 2 minutes and then repeated every 15 mins. It's probably a virus issue you need to get checked. Because with 8GB RAM and CSS requiring only somewhat 512MB it should run very smoothly even with other programs on.
